Dr. Kathryn Lenker grew up in the suburbs of Philadelphia. She attended Bucknell University and received a Bachelor of Science in Biology with a Geography minor. In 2020. She graduated with her VMD from the University of Pennsylvania School of Veterinary Medicine in 2024. At Penn, she studied mixed animal medicine and did research focused on infectious diseases and greenhouse gases in food animals. She also received a Master of Public Health from the University of Pennsylvania Perelman School of Medicine in 2023.
Dr. Lenker completed her rotating internship in small animal medicine and surgery at Metropolitan Veterinary Associates, where she spent the majority of her time with the Emergency Service.
Dr. Lenker has special interests in emergency and critical care medicine, as well as public health and preventative medicine.
In her free time, she enjoys running, spending time with friends and family, and watching her favorite Phillies.
